Consider a test to determine if data are generated by the Poisson distribution. One pro cedure for attempting to resolve questions of disputed authorship is to count the num- ber of occurrences of particular words in blocks of text. These can be compared with results from passages whose authorship is known, often this comparison can be achieved through the assumption that the number of occurrences follows a Poisson distribution An example of this type of research involves the study of the Federalist Papers (Mosteller and Wallace 1964) 142 Goodness Test Population des Links 589 u25 Example 14.4 Federalist Papers (Chi-Square) For a sample of 252 blocks of text (each apprecimately 230 words in length) from The Fed- erald Papers (Mosteller and Wallace 1961), the mean number of occurrences of the word many was 0.66. Table 14.7 shows the observed frequencies of occurrence of this word in the 262 sampled blocks of text.
